Evapotranspiration; Weather data; Software; Object-oriented programming
The FAO-56 Penman-Monteith combination equation (FAO-56 PM) has been recommended as the standard equation for estimating reference evapotranspiration (ET0). The FAO-56 PM equation requires the numerous weather data that are not available in the most of the stations. The main goal of this paper is to present the software for estimating reference evapotranspiration, focusing on the feature of using limited weather data. This is simple Windows-based and user-friendly software provides methods to estimate extra-terrestrial radiation, maximum sunshine hours, daily net radiation and daily/monthly ET0. The program is written in C# and includes comprehensive technical documentation. The software is available for free download. The weather data for this study were obtained from CIMIS for Davis weather station. The reduced-set FAO-56 PM approaches and adjusted Hargreaves equation were compared to the full-set FAO-56 PM equation. The FAO-56 reduced-set PM ET0 estimates were in closest agreement with FAO-56 full-set PM ET estimates. The adjusted Hargreaves equation (AHARG) was found to be in very good agreement with the full-set FAO-56 PM. This program is the first software facilitating calculation of ET only with air temperature parameter. (C) 2010 Elsevier B.V. All rights reserved.
